I think the Sybex "MCTS Microsoft Exchange Server 2007 Configuration" Study Guide is an excellent resource. The material is thorough, I didn't find any errors in the book, each chapter has a sample test, and there are two full sample exams. Recommended. ISBN 978-0-470-06819-9 Regards, Michael B.
